WebHiring a background investigator will ensure that there is nothing in the person's past that could put the company or an individual person at risk. Studying a someone’s background includes looking at his or her criminal, job, and credit history. In some cases, the person's personality and temperament are also studied. In some locations, you may need certification and a … grass valley clark canyon cwmuWebBeing an NCIS Special Agent is one of the most challenging and fulfilling careers in law enforcement. NCIS Special Agents gain broad law enforcement experience and are given responsibility early on in their careers. Special Agents travel the globe and may even be stationed aboard a ship.
